Adopting a Dogue de Bordeaux Puppy
Dogue de Bordeaux puppies, like any breed, are irresistibly cute and bring their own set of joys and challenges.
Pros of Adopting a Dogue de Bordeaux Puppy:
Early Training and Bonding: Adopting a puppy means you have the opportunity to train and socialize them from an early age, ensuring they grow into well-behaved adult dogs. This period also allows for a strong bond to form between you and your dog.
Growing Together: Seeing a tiny Dogue de Bordeaux puppy grow into its impressive adult size can be an exciting and fulfilling experience.
Longer Time Together: Puppies offer the prospect of a long companionship, provided they enjoy a healthy life.
Cons of Adopting a Dogue de Bordeaux Puppy:
Time and Energy Commitment: Puppies require significant time and energy for training, socialization, and general care. This can be especially challenging with a large and strong breed like the Dogue de Bordeaux.
Unpredictable Adult Characteristics: Puppies can change as they mature. Their health, temperament, and physical features can evolve, and these are difficult to predict.
Higher Upfront Costs: Puppies often require initial veterinary costs like vaccinations, spaying/neutering, and microchipping.
Adopting an Adult Dogue de Bordeaux
Adopting an adult Dogue de Bordeaux can be an incredibly rewarding experience, but it comes with its own considerations.
Pros of Adopting an Adult Dogue de Bordeaux:
Predictable Traits: An adult Dogue de Bordeaux’s size, personality, and health status are already known, so you have a clear picture of what to expect.
Basic Training: Many adult dogs have been trained in basic commands, which can save time and reduce the challenge of training.
Less Active: While still requiring exercise, adult Dogue de Bordeauxs are typically less active than puppies and may fit better into a more relaxed lifestyle.
Cons of Adopting an Adult Dogue de Bordeaux:
Potential Health Problems: Adult dogs may come with pre-existing health conditions, which could lead to more frequent vet visits and associated costs.
Behavioral Issues: Adult dogs, particularly if they’ve had a rough past, might come with some behavioral issues. However, with patience and consistency, these can often be resolved.
Adjustment Period: An adult dog may require some time to adjust to their new home and form a bond with their new family.
